Why January in Warri Feels Like a Dream

Warri’s January weather is a traveller’s delight, characterised by low humidity, minimal rainfall, and plenty of sunshine. Average daytime highs reach 30-32°C, with lows dipping to 21-23°C after sunset, warm enough for outdoor adventures yet cool enough for comfortable evenings. Rainfall is scarce, with only about 1-2 wet days on average, making it the driest month of the year. This dry spell transforms the city’s landscapes, from lush mangroves to bustling markets, into accessible playgrounds free from mud and mosquitoes.

For business travellers, the stable January Warri weather means fewer disruptions to schedules, whether you’re heading to meetings at the Warri Refining and Petrochemical Company or networking at local events. Families and solo explorers appreciate the milder conditions for picnics and sightseeing, while the reduced haze offers clearer views of the Niger Delta’s stunning vistas.

Unmissable Warri January Attractions: A Blend of Nature and Culture

January in Warri offers a wealth of attractions that highlight the region’s rich ethnic heritage, particularly from the Itsekiri, Urhobo, and Ijaw communities. The dry weather amplifies these experiences, allowing for comfortable exploration of historical sites, natural parks, and vibrant markets.

Key Warri January attractions include the Red Mangrove Swamp, where boardwalks wind through lush wetlands teeming with wildlife like monkeys and birds, perfect for a serene nature walk under clear skies. Nearby, the Falcorp Mangrove Park offers eco-tourism adventures, including guided tours that educate on the Delta’s biodiversity.

For a cultural immersion, visit the Palace of the Olu of Warri (Ode-Itsekiri), a symbol of Itsekiri royalty with intricate architecture and historical artefacts. In January’s mild weather, it’s an excellent time to explore the grounds and learn about local traditions.

Insider Tips & Seasonal Alerts for January in Warri

Packing Essentials

  • Lightweight clothing, sunscreen, and a reusable water bottle, January’s warmth calls for breathable fabrics.
  • Insect repellent for mangrove visits, though dry conditions reduce bugs.
  • Portable power bank, as exploring might drain your devices.

Navigation Hacks

  • Use ride-hailing apps like Bolt for safe, affordable transport.
  • Download offline maps; signal can be spotty in rural areas.
  • Carry small naira notes for markets and tips.

Health & Safety
